Frequently Asked Questions
What position count and pitch does the TFC-106-02-LM-D-A-K-TR offer for board-to-board interconnection?
The TFC-106-02-LM-D-A-K-TR provides 12 total contact positions in a dual-row arrangement with 6 positions per row at 0.050" (1.27 mm) pitch. This compact configuration is suitable for routing small signal buses or mixed power-and-signal groups between two PCBs in space-constrained embedded designs such as wearable devices or compact industrial sensor modules.
How does the left-angle (LM) mating on the TFC-106-02-LM-D-A-K-TR benefit low-clearance board designs?
The left-angle mating orientation allows the mating connector to engage from the side rather than top-down, reducing the required vertical clearance above the connector by the full mating height. In stacked PCB assemblies with less than 5 mm inter-board spacing, the left-angle approach enables connections that vertical connectors cannot accommodate without requiring additional board separation.
Why would a manufacturer choose the TR (tape-and-reel) version of the TFC-106-02-LM-D-A-K-TR for production?
The tape-and-reel version supports automated SMT pick-and-place assembly by providing connectors in a standardized carrier tape format compatible with IEC 60286 feeders. For production runs of thousands of units, TR packaging reduces manual handling time, eliminates tray-to-feeder loading steps, and maintains consistent part orientation for robotic placement of the 12-position connector with sub-millimeter accuracy.
